From 2b65de60e806560b367b5ed0e230aaea9d90b312 Mon Sep 17 00:00:00 2001
From: Tristan Walter <twalter@orn.mpg.de>
Date: Sat, 10 Oct 2020 13:30:48 +0200
Subject: [PATCH] include in all

---
 Application/CMakeLists.txt | 25 ++++++++++++++++---------
 1 file changed, 16 insertions(+), 9 deletions(-)

diff --git a/Application/CMakeLists.txt b/Application/CMakeLists.txt
index 23af8ab..8edc6cd 100644
--- a/Application/CMakeLists.txt
+++ b/Application/CMakeLists.txt
@@ -576,16 +576,23 @@ if(NOT TREX_BUILD_ZIP)
     endif()
 endif()
 
-
-if(WIN32)
-	if(TREX_BUILD_ZLIB)
-		set(trex_subproject_CMAKE_ARGS ${trex_subproject_CMAKE_ARGS}
-			-DCMAKE_PREFIX_PATH=${zlib_install_dir}/lib/zlib.lib
+if(TREX_BUILD_ZLIB)
+    if(WIN32)
+        set(trex_subproject_CMAKE_ARGS ${trex_subproject_CMAKE_ARGS}
+            -DCMAKE_PREFIX_PATH=${zlib_install_dir}/lib/zlib.lib
             -DZLIB_LIBRARY:FILEPATH=${zlib_install_dir}/lib/zlib.lib
-			-DZLIB_LIBRARY_RELEASE:FILEPATH=${zlib_install_dir}/lib/zlib.lib 
-			-DZLIB_LIBRARY_RELWITHDEBINFO:FILEPATH=${zlib_install_dir}/lib/zlib.lib 
-			-DZLIB_LIBRARY_DEBUG:FILEPATH=${zlib_install_dir}/lib/zlibd.lib)
-	endif()
+            -DZLIB_LIBRARY_RELEASE:FILEPATH=${zlib_install_dir}/lib/zlib.lib
+            -DZLIB_LIBRARY_RELWITHDEBINFO:FILEPATH=${zlib_install_dir}/lib/zlib.lib
+            -DZLIB_LIBRARY_DEBUG:FILEPATH=${zlib_install_dir}/lib/zlibd.lib)
+        
+    else()
+        set(trex_subproject_CMAKE_ARGS ${trex_subproject_CMAKE_ARGS}
+            -DZLIB_INCLUDE_DIR:PATH=${zlib_install_dir}/include
+            -DZLIB_LIBRARY_RELEASE:FILEPATH=${zlib_install_dir}/lib/libz.a
+            -DZLIB_LIBRARY_RELWITHDEBINFO:FILEPATH=${zlib_install_dir}/lib/libz.a
+            -DZLIB_LIBRARY_DEBUG:FILEPATH=${zlib_install_dir}/lib/libzd.a
+        )
+    endif()
 endif()
 
 if(TREX_BUILD_ZIP)
-- 
GitLab